I followed up my phone calls with an email that looked like this:

Code:
My company sent these two payments to TerraHash, Inc. via PayPal
 
 
TXID: ##
 
Invoice ID: WC-###
Date: Jun ##, ####
Time: ##:##:## PDT
 
-$#,###.## USD

TXID: ##
Invoice ID: WC-###
Date: Jun ##, ####
Time: ##:##:## PDT
-$#,###.## USD
 
 
 
The payments were for pre-sale computer hardware which was to be shipped by August ##th, ####.  The computer hardware has not been shipped and no shipping timeline is known at this time.
 
I have contacted TerraHash and requested refunds on August ##, ####.  TerraHash has not replied to my requests as of August ##, ####.
 
I believe TerraHash is violating the following PayPal Policies:
 
 (d) are for the sale of certain items before the seller has control or possession of the item,
Breach any law, statute, contract, or regulation
 
#.# b) Breach any law, statute, contract, or regulation .
 
TerraHash is required by the Federal Trade Commission to issue a refund upon request since they have not shipped any product.  No sale has been made.
 
#.# l)
Conduct your business or use the Services in a manner that results in or may result in complaints, Disputes, Claims, Reversals, Chargebacks, fees, fines, penalties and other liability to PayPal, a User, a third party or you;
 
TerraHash has a huge number of people complaining in the BitCoin community and there is going to be a huge rash of chargebacks and complaints very shortly as they are no where near delivering on their promises to their customers.
 
 
TerraHash has violated your terms of service which clearly state that the seller "Guarantees shipment within ## days from the date of purchase".  This applies to pre-sale items.
 
 
Please refund my payments. 
 
Thanks for taking the time to review my request. You can contact me via email or one of the phone numbers below.

  • I sent an email to [email protected] in which I listed my transaction and dispute number, and explained how BFL is violating the ToS.

FYI, that email address isn't accepting fraud complaints at this time.  Instead you can send your information/request to [email protected].

I spent a couple hours on the phone with various 'supervisors' in the paypal business services department.  They will mostly say 'since you are past the 45 day windows, there's nothing we can do' over and over.  But if you keep pointing out how BFL/TerraHash/other naughty ASIC company/ is violating their terms of service, committing mail/wire fraud, violating FTC regulations etc. they will eventually cave and open a case for a refund.

I recently received a full refund from BFL for an order I placed several months ago.

I know, I know, BFL claims that "all sales are final".  Well, there's "final", and then there's "final"...

It took a month, but here's what worked for me:

  • I sent an email to [email protected] in which I politely requested a refund.
  • About a week later, I received a reply from BFL denying my request.
  • I filed a dispute with PayPal. In this dispute I noted that BFL failed to deliver, denied my refund request, and violated PayPal's Terms of Service for pre-order sales.
  • PayPal closed my dispute the same day, stating that I was outside the 45-day window.
  • I called PayPal's customer service and complained about my dispute being closed, and explained to PayPal exactly how BFL is violating the ToS.
  • I sent an email to [email protected] in which I listed my transaction and dispute number, and explained how BFL is violating the ToS.
  • A few days later, a PayPal Customer Solutions Supervisor called me on the phone. He had already spoken to BFL and assured me that BFL would be contacting me. I told him that I just wanted a refund, and explained to him how BFL is violating the ToS.
  • I waited a week to give BFL plenty of time to contact me.  They didn't.
  • I emailed the PayPal Customer Solutions Supervisor and told him that BFL had not contacted me. He seemed shocked. I wasn't. He told me that PayPal could take action against BFL if necessary.
  • The PayPal Customer Solutions Supervisor escalated my dispute to the next level (whatever that is).  He told me that someone else would call.
  • The next day I received a call from a guy named Bruce at BFL. He told me that since I had complained to PayPal, BFL was placing my order "under review" and taking it out of the queue. From his tone, I got the impression that Bruce thought this would bother me. I told him that I didn't need a review, I just wanted my money back. He wouldn't give me a firm answer and just kept repeating that they were placing my order "under review" and taking it out of the queue. I even asked if this review would take a day, week, month, or year. No answer, just the same "under review" statement.
  • Within 5 minutes of BFL's call, an Account Representative from PayPal called. I told her about the strange conversation with Bruce. She said that she would contact BFL again.
  • My payment to BFL was refunded to my PayPal account the next business day.

IMHO, this is the bottom line:

BFL needs PayPal. If you want your money back, complain to PayPal and don't give up.

Public Service Announcement!

If you have ordered from ButterFly Labs and have not yet received your product, you are entitled to a refund whenever you request one (per FTC rules).
First ask ButterFly Labs for a refund, they will probably say no but you might get lucky.
If you ordered via PayPal you can file a complaint with them even if you are outside the 45 day window. Multiple customers have already gotten a refund from PayPal that was outside the 45 days.
If you ordered via Bitcoin or Bank wire, you can fill out a complaint with the FTC and they will advocate for you with ButterFly Labs to get your refund. You can also contact the office of the Kansas Attorney General and inform them that you have had your money taken with no product delivered for months, just more promises.
You can also do a paper filing with the DA here: http://da.jocogov.org/complaint-forms
